What is the difference between Barge Inspection Company vs Barge Inspector?

AspectBarge Inspection CompanyBarge Inspector
CredentialsCompany licenses, certifications, and qualified inspectorsIndividual certifications like USCG licenses, marine inspection certifications
Work EnvironmentOperates across multiple vessels and locations, often on-sitePrimarily on vessels or at inspection sites, performing physical inspections
Employer & Industry UsageProvides inspection services for multiple clients in maritime and shipping industriesWorks as an employee or contractor performing inspections for vessels

In summary, a Barge Inspection Company is an organization that offers inspection services, while a Barge Inspector is an individual professional conducting the inspections. Both roles are essential in ensuring vessel safety and compliance, with the company managing operations and the inspector executing the inspections.

POSITION OVERVIEW:
The Barge Readiness Technician will be responsible for tank barge inspections prior to loading and unloading of products. This position will also be responsible for barge inspections after a barge cleaning operation has occurred. Willingness to work outside and ability to learn about tank barges is a must. The job is based in various ports but does require daily travel to local jobsites, necessitating reliable transportation.
CORE ACCOUNTABILITIES & RESPONSIBILITIES:
Overall
  • Accountable for ensuring barges are ready to perform a cargo transfer (load/discharge)

  • Accountable for ensuring there are no customer rejections on barges you have inspected (to include cleaning)

  • Accountable for performing your work safely

  • Reliable - show up on time and ready to work

  • Inspect barge hulls, documentation, cleanliness, safety systems. machinery and fittings

Conduct Tank Barge Inspections:
  • Inspection of barge voids (empty ballast tanks)

  • Reading and understanding tank barge documents (USCG COI, SDS, Strappings, COFR)

  • Starting of barge pump engine and inspection for defects

  • Inspect all other working equipment and machinery on the barge

  • Inspect and verify barge cleanliness before the barge leaves cleaning facilities

  • Examination of decks to ensure they are clear from spills (cargo or engine fluids).

  • Visual inspection to locate hull damage and void tank leaks

  • Inspection of all barge fittings including operation of winches

  • Inspection of vapor recovery systems on tank barges, including all piping and pressure vacuum relief valve (PVRV).

  • Review of the functions/operations of the cargo tanks, cargo piping, cargo tank valves, pump cans, check valve, pressure relief on pumps and hot oil heaters.

  • Extensive attention to detail required.

  • Ability to document work and complete forms

  • Stay compliant with all regulatory bodies as it applies to the work that is being completed and with all safety rules and policies.

  • Perform other duties as required and directed by management.

  • This position will involve daily travel to multiple locations. Travel expenses will be reimbursed.

  • Assist as needed with barge operations.

Perform minor preventative and corrective maintenance on barge pumps, pump engines, boilers, and heaters;
  • Troubleshoot and perform minor repair of components on both Detroit Diesel and Cummins engines (Mechanical Skills)

  • Identify issues and maintain fuel systems, gear boxes, couplings, drive shafts, deep well pumps, positive displacement pumps, and centrifugal pumps. (Troubleshooting Skills)

  • Understand the functions/operations and perform minor repair of the cargo high-level alarms, both mechanical and electrical.
